To present the concepts involved with signals and systems. Namely:
Signal Classification, Representation and Analysis
Fourier Series
Fourier Transform
Laplace Transform
Linear Time-invariant (LTI) Systems and Filters
Noise Remove in Digital (data) and Analogue Systems
A. Demonstrate a clear understanding of the use of Fourier Series to represent periodic continuous time signals.
B. Demonstrate a clear understanding of the use of the Fourier Transform to represent finite energy signals.
C. Demonstrate a clear understanding of Laplace Transform, its properties and its use in circuit and system analysis.
D. Demonstrate a clear understanding of Linear Time Invariant Systems, and filters.
E. Demonstrate the ability to analyse various signals in both the time and frequency domains.
This module will be delivered by a combination of formal lectures, problem classes, class demonstrations, and case studies.
